Summary

The Baltimore Ravens conducted workouts for former New York Giants wide receivers Sterling Shepard and Dante Pettis on Friday. Shepard, who has spent eight seasons in the NFL, amassed 372 receptions for 4,095 yards with the Giants before his stint with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ers. Pettis, acquired via waivers in 2020, caught 14 passes in five games with New York before later playing for the Chicago Bears and New Orleans Saints. Both players remain free agents as the Ravens consider their options at wide receiver.
